Dux Security provides an AI‑driven exposure management platform that evaluates the exploitability of vulnerabilities using graph‑based asset mapping, threat intelligence, and contextual risk scoring. The system prioritizes true risks, recommends lightweight mitigations, and automates remediation workflows across on‑prem and cloud environments via a real‑time dashboard and API.

Problem
Security teams are inundated with vulnerability data but lack a reliable way to determine which findings are truly exploitable, leading to wasted effort on low‑risk issues. The accelerating pace of attacks shortens the window between discovery and exploitation, making manual triage and patching too slow to keep systems safe.
Solution
Dux Security delivers an agentic exposure management platform that uses autonomous AI agents to evaluate the exploitability of each vulnerability in the context of an organization’s asset graph. By correlating assets, controls, and threat intelligence, the system distinguishes merely reachable flaws from those that can be actively breached. It then surfaces lightweight mitigation actions—such as configuration changes or control deployments—that can be applied immediately, reducing reliance on full patches. When remediation is required, the AI agents orchestrate data collection, ownership assignment, and workflow automation to accelerate fix deployment across heterogeneous environments. All analysis, scoring, and recommendations are presented through a real‑time dashboard and API, enabling security operations to prioritize true risks and achieve protection at machine speed.
Target Audience
The primary users are security operations (SecOps) and vulnerability management teams in mid‑size to large enterprises, as well as managed security service providers that need to prioritize and remediate high‑impact exposures efficiently.
Features
- AI‑driven exploitability engine that simulates attack paths using graph‑based asset‑vulnerability mapping
- Contextual risk scoring that incorporates threat intel, asset criticality, and existing controls
- Lightweight mitigation recommendation engine suggesting config tweaks, policy updates, or temporary controls
- Autonomous remediation agents that auto‑tag assets, assign owners, and trigger patch or configuration workflows across on‑prem and cloud stacks
- Unified data ingestion layer that normalizes feeds from scanners, CMDBs, ticketing systems, and SIEMs
- Real‑time security operations dashboard with drill‑down visualizations and API access for integration with SOAR platforms
- Built‑in compliance reporting aligned with SOC 2, ISO 27001, and NIST CSF requirements
